tx · 8ynsf8TJY22koQMP3obUDcmtMZEg37jUKzdJ4foLg8bb

3N7eEzkCtBoWaNRe4ZuTPrChbnjBLKDb9Bx:  -0.01000000 Waves

2023.05.28 14:55 [2597787] smart account 3N7eEzkCtBoWaNRe4ZuTPrChbnjBLKDb9Bx > SELF 0.00000000 Waves

{ "type": 13, "id": "8ynsf8TJY22koQMP3obUDcmtMZEg37jUKzdJ4foLg8bb", "fee": 1000000, "feeAssetId": null, "timestamp": 1685274952231, "version": 2, "chainId": 84, "sender": "3N7eEzkCtBoWaNRe4ZuTPrChbnjBLKDb9Bx", "senderPublicKey": "2NK7BrUZMvnHzAoHnJfz3FuDBP5zYUNoxshB49AH2kbc", "proofs": [ "5dj9eAh1zpNx1bNhd9VHG4LNyF1LT5Nnq6mApAyM1gyYYJF5GLbmHcHNRXV2RsqKcbAAxNyVfEpjAvDXvA58rcDH" ], "script": "base64:BgIJCAISABIDCgEBAAIBaQENdG9rZW5Jc3N1YW5jZQAEBG5hbWUCCkJlYnJhVG9rZW4EDmxlbmRlc2NyaXB0aW9uAg9CZWJyYSBieSBLcmluZ2UECHF1YW50aXR5AICt4gQECGRlY2ltYWxzAAAEDGlzUmVpc3N1YWJsZQYECmlzc3VlQmVicmEJAMMIBwUEbmFtZQUObGVuZGVzY3JpcHRpb24FCHF1YW50aXR5BQhkZWNpbWFscwUMaXNSZWlzc3VhYmxlBQR1bml0AAAEB2Fzc2V0SWQJALgIAQUKaXNzdWVCZWJyYQQJa25ld1Rva2VuAgVUb2tlbgQLZ2V0TmV3VG9rZW4JARN2YWx1ZU9yRXJyb3JNZXNzYWdlAgkAnQgCBQR0aGlzBQlrbmV3VG9rZW4CGUJlYnJhVG9rZW4gaXMgbm90IGRlZmluZWQECXJlY2lwaWVudAgFAWkGY2FsbGVyCQDMCAIFCmlzc3VlQmVicmEJAMwIAgkBDlNjcmlwdFRyYW5zZmVyAwUJcmVjaXBpZW50ANAPBQdhc3NldElkBQNuaWwBaQENdG9rZW5UcmFuc2ZlcgEGYW1vdW50BAlyZWNpcGllbnQJANgEAQgIBQFpBmNhbGxlcgVieXRlcwUDbmlsAQJ0eAEGdmVyaWZ5AAkA9AMDCAUCdHgJYm9keUJ5dGVzCQCRAwIIBQJ0eAZwcm9vZnMAAAgFAnR4D3NlbmRlclB1YmxpY0tleaotgyQ=", "height": 2597787, "applicationStatus": "succeeded", "spentComplexity": 0 } View: original | compacted Prev: Huj8U4pda59oypqYfpm2Yck5SPxp7XYZvSQuN1XEpwwS Next: Cmnhk6hVRGhZbnRHB8ixYNbtU32h8XfynuBeBgHYnfgA Diff:
OldNewDifferences
1010 let quantity = 10000000
1111 let decimals = 0
1212 let isReissuable = true
13- let assetBebra = Issue(name, lendescription, quantity, decimals, isReissuable, unit, 0)
14- let assetId = calculateAssetId(assetBebra)
13+ let issueBebra = Issue(name, lendescription, quantity, decimals, isReissuable, unit, 0)
14+ let assetId = calculateAssetId(issueBebra)
1515 let knewToken = "Token"
16- let newToken = valueOrErrorMessage(getString(this, knewToken), "BebraToken is not defined")
16+ let getNewToken = valueOrErrorMessage(getString(this, knewToken), "BebraToken is not defined")
1717 let recipient = i.caller
18-[assetBebra, StringEntry(knewToken, newToken), ScriptTransfer(recipient, 2000, assetId)]
18+[issueBebra, ScriptTransfer(recipient, 2000, assetId)]
1919 }
2020
2121
Full:
OldNewDifferences
11 {-# STDLIB_VERSION 6 #-}
22 {-# SCRIPT_TYPE ACCOUNT #-}
33 {-# CONTENT_TYPE DAPP #-}
44
55
66 @Callable(i)
77 func tokenIssuance () = {
88 let name = "BebraToken"
99 let lendescription = "Bebra by Kringe"
1010 let quantity = 10000000
1111 let decimals = 0
1212 let isReissuable = true
13- let assetBebra = Issue(name, lendescription, quantity, decimals, isReissuable, unit, 0)
14- let assetId = calculateAssetId(assetBebra)
13+ let issueBebra = Issue(name, lendescription, quantity, decimals, isReissuable, unit, 0)
14+ let assetId = calculateAssetId(issueBebra)
1515 let knewToken = "Token"
16- let newToken = valueOrErrorMessage(getString(this, knewToken), "BebraToken is not defined")
16+ let getNewToken = valueOrErrorMessage(getString(this, knewToken), "BebraToken is not defined")
1717 let recipient = i.caller
18-[assetBebra, StringEntry(knewToken, newToken), ScriptTransfer(recipient, 2000, assetId)]
18+[issueBebra, ScriptTransfer(recipient, 2000, assetId)]
1919 }
2020
2121
2222
2323 @Callable(i)
2424 func tokenTransfer (amount) = {
2525 let recipient = toBase58String(i.caller.bytes)
2626 nil
2727 }
2828
2929
3030 @Verifier(tx)
3131 func verify () = sigVerify(tx.bodyBytes, tx.proofs[0], tx.senderPublicKey)
3232

github/deemru/w8io/169f3d6 
31.48 ms